Output abc4e4fbeb53ddac9f7ffbe5a5286c4a5a0a76f5edbdb035c754a92afa150170:30

value
521286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1188c828dc8840580c74a65aeb244b9b8d15d82a OP_EQUAL
address
33HjGaN6fFRTw9Rd7msKgigzZtm6ePYpqv
transaction
abc4e4fbeb53ddac9f7ffbe5a5286c4a5a0a76f5edbdb035c754a92afa150170
confirmations
278906
spent
false